I've added some 2x, 4x, and 8x files to make lining up in Cura easier (I did them all one-by-one when I did my prints :P then realized it would have been easier doing it in Fusion 360 first, rather than entering in XYZ coordinates over and over in Cura) Instructions for how to line these up in Cura for printing: Now you have some two-tone tokens :) If your printer does any leveling probing you may need to disable that before you do the second, overlaid print or else it'd think something's wrong
